    Ranking-based matchmaking is not about punishing people who cause problems. It's meant to provide consistently close racing outside of dedicated leagues. No one wants to be in that race where two aliens leave everyone in their dust while five newbies crash in turn 1 and quit, leaving the average sim racer cruising alone for 20 minutes. Unfortunately, that is difficult to achieve unless you have the iRacing player base of thousands of brainwash... dedicated players.

    But you are completely right that if ranking based race management shall work so people only race against others with about the same rating then the sim needs thousands of participants.
    And I can tell you with some personal experience that even iRacing have ghost town series that cant even gather the minimum numbers (5-7 drivers) for a race to go official.:whistle:

    Thats the main reason that i keep my membership in iracing. The ranking system help to balance the level of the pilots at the race.

    Of course, always there will be aliens in a room, but, usually, are fair races and always has some battles for positions, because no one wanna loss their safety rating.

    So, if we had MP Ranking, i do believe it will estimulate the MP a little bit.

    The fact the Iracing only has MP races with fixed time, and you will lost rating if did not finished(if u disconnnect or something), make their players to be more loyal to finished the race. Rating is like a drug, you always want more.
